Ariane Locat is a scholar working on Civil and Structural Engineering, Management, Monitoring, Policy and Law and Safety, Risk, Reliability and Quality. According to data from OpenAlex, Ariane Locat has authored 24 papers receiving a total of 447 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Civil and Structural Engineering, 17 papers in Management, Monitoring, Policy and Law and 8 papers in Safety, Risk, Reliability and Quality. Recurrent topics in Ariane Locat's work include Landslides and related hazards (17 papers), Soil and Unsaturated Flow (10 papers) and Geotechnical Engineering and Analysis (8 papers). Ariane Locat is often cited by papers focused on Landslides and related hazards (17 papers), Soil and Unsaturated Flow (10 papers) and Geotechnical Engineering and Analysis (8 papers). Ariane Locat collaborates with scholars based in Canada, Norway and United States. Ariane Locat's co-authors include Serge Leroueil, Denis Demers, Hans Petter Jostad, Pascal Locat, Jacques Locat, Jean‐Sébastien L’Heureux, Dominique Turmel, H Jostad, A. Fortin and Michel Jaboyedoff and has published in prestigious journals such as SHILAP Revista de lepidopterología, Canadian Geotechnical Journal and Landslides.
